The J looks like the L, but the G and H both look like the rest of the early models with the sloped back dual air intakes under the prop instead of the flat triple intakes of the J and L.

The reason for the difference in the intakes was that the J and L had core type (made like radiators) intercoolers with the cooling inlets below the props, while all of the earlier versions had the intercoolers in the leading edges of the outer wings.

So only a J model could be done without signifcant alteration of the actual graphic model, anything like a G or H would require a serious rework, as would an M, which would require a hump behind the pilot for the RO.

id put my vote on the p38F and p38H being most beneficial for varieties sake

though an addition of a p38J to the p38F and H would really make the p38 set complete the way the 109 set is. the J being a tad faster with no dive flaps or boosted ailerons would be a variation of performance between the H and the L.

P-38H is an excellent choice because it will make scenarios much more balanced when the setup is 1943 luftwaffe against b17s and p38H's escorting. also the mediteranean theatre used early model p38s long after the j and L was available.

The early model J meaning J-15-Lo and earlier, WITHOUT dive flaps? The only advantage of the early J over the G and H is power level, and that is handicapped by added weight.

Not much difference between the G and the H, and pilots of the 20TH and 55TH FG's told me that they had at least as many H models as G models, so I doubt it really matters.
